A) The number of cans of Campbell’s soup on your local supermarket's shelf today at 6:00 p.m.
Census. It would be easy enough to count all of them.
B) The proportion of soup sales last week in Boston that was sold under the Campbell's brand.
Sample. It would be too costly to track each can.
C) The proportion of Campbell’s brand soup cans in your family's pantry.
Census. You can count them all quickly and cheaply.
